The Secrets of Seed Stashing
Some squirrels are a remarkable ability to recall the locations of their hidden nuts. It's a skill vital for survival through the winter months.
These bushy-tailed hoarders often hide thousands of seeds, and they aren't able to always remember every single one. But don't worry, forests enjoys from their efforts.
The seeds that remain often sprout, helping to spread forests and support biodiversity. So next time you see a squirrel hustling around, reflect on the surprising secret of seed stashing.
